linux pm2的安装及使用

linux pm2的安装及使用,第1张

npm run dev的服务想放在服务器上,但是putty一断服务就没了。

网上差了下forever和pm2用的比较多,猜腊尤其是pm2 简直太好用了。。

具体 *** 作如下

安装

npm install -g pm2

如果发现pm2找不到命令,做一下连接

找到pm2在本机的安装目录,以下这渗迅个命令一定要先用whereis pm2找到pm2的安装路径,每台机器安装的路径是不同的

如穗喊滑果连接建立错误,可以到/usr/local/bin/下 rm 掉pm2 ,可以看见pm2是红色的。

ln -s /usr/local/src/node/bin/pm2 /usr/local/bin/pm2

又比如:ln -s /usr/local/node-v8.11.3/out/bin/pm2 /usr/local/bin/pm2

https://my.oschina.net/u/2252639/blog/1798667

启动服务(原服务是通过npm run dev启动)

pm2 start npm -- run dev

如果原服务是node app启动的话,就用 pm2 start app.js --name uops

也可以找package.json里的配置,例如

"scripts": {

"dev": "nodemon index.js"

}

终止 pm2 stop

列举出所有用pm2启动的程序: pm2 list

查看启动程序的详细信息: pm2 describe** id**

本文首发地址: 开源实践网返缺谈:ubuntu 18.04 安装 Redis

pm2 是一个 Node.js 应用的进程管理器,它可以让你的应用程序保持运行,还有一个内建的负载均衡器。它非常简单而且强大,你可以零间断重启或重新加载你的 node 应用,它也允许你为你的 node 应用创建集群。

更新apt-get

已经安装过得同学漏碰可以跳过这一步

安装 NodeJS:

检测node版本

安装npm

然后我们安装 n 来管理 nodejs 版本:

上面的有点旧,安装最新的稳定版nodejs

使用如下命令安装

查看帮助,看到提示扮启就说明成功了

pm2 常见命令


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/12381835.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-25
下一篇 2023-05-25

发表评论

登录后才能评论

评论列表(0条)

保存